The Inverloch Acreage Advantage: Location Meets Lifestyle

Coastal Proximity with Rural Privacy


Inverloch acreage properties offer the rare combination of coastal access and rural space. Most of our featured acreage homes are located within 10-15 minutes of Inverloch's famous surf beaches, yet provide the peace and privacy that only comes with substantial land holdings. This unique positioning makes Inverloch acreage some of the most valuable rural real estate in Victoria.


Growing Infrastructure and Connectivity



The Bass Coast region has seen significant infrastructure improvements, making Inverloch acreage properties more accessible than ever. The South Gippsland Highway provides direct access to Melbourne in under two hours, while local amenities continue to expand. This improved connectivity has driven increased interest in Inverloch homes and acreage from both sea-change seekers and investors.

Due Diligence and Settlement



Purchasing acreage property involves additional considerations compared to standard residential sales. Our team guides you through:

  • Property inspections including buildings, fencing, and water systems
  • Title searches to identify any easements or restrictions
  • Council inquiries regarding zoning and future development plans
  • Environmental assessments where required

It feels awkward to switch agents mid-campaign. How do I even do that?

Most listing agreements include a defined termination or review period. A short, written notice to your current agent is usually sufficient. Leo can walk you through the specific wording during the strategy call and provide a sample notice if helpful. Many vendors find the switch less difficult than the months they've already spent waiting.

What does list-to-sale price accuracy actually mean?

It measures how close an agent's listed price sits to the eventual sale price. A high ratio signals honest pricing. Leo Edwards sits at 91.9 percent across his 2024 to 2025 sold listings. Methodology available on request.

What is Openn Offers and why use it?

Openn Offers is a transparent online sales platform that lets every qualified buyer see competing offers in real time. Transparent competition lifts sale prices in coastal markets where buyers are dispersed across Melbourne, interstate, and local. Leo was one of the earliest Victorian adopters.
